A Catoosa County deputy last Thursday found the body of Ringgold High wrestler Randy Johnston in a wooded area in the Equestrian Heights subdivision, Sheriff Phil Summers said.

Johnston, 18, was last seen Saturday, July 9, when he told his mother he was going for a run. When Johnston, who lives in the subdivision, didn’t return that night, the family filed a missing person report with the Sheriff’s Department.

It is believed that Johnston died on the evening of his disappearance between 7 and 9 p.m.

“We do not suspect foul play at this point, but the investigation is still under-way,” Catoosa County coroner Vanita Hullander said Monday. “Right now, we’re looking into a possible cause of death by lightning or maybe some of the power lines in the area — we just don’t know yet.”

Officials hope to have answers in the next week.

Catoosa County Sheriff Phil Summers echoed Hullander’s comments.

“We’re awaiting official determination (of cause of death) from the crime lab, but we hope to know something soon,” he said. “We don’t anticipate the discovery of any foul play.”

“I desperately want to give this family some answers,” said Hullander. “It’s just going to take some time.
